Gainers on Unusual Volume

Shares of Walter Energy Inc. ( NYSE: WLT ) are seeing huge activity in
today's trading. The stock touched a 52-week high of $111.67, and closed 4.66%
higher at $110.52, with volume up from daily average of 1.87 million to 8.24
million. The Walter Energy stock has a 52-week range of $57.62-$111.67.
Year-to-date, the stock is up 46.75%, outperforming the S&P 500. Walter Energy
today extended its exclusivity agreement with Western Coal Corp. As per the
agreement, the two companies are working exclusively with each other toward the
negotiation of a definitive agreement to give effect to Walter's proposal for
a possible business combination. Shares of Deckers Outdoor Corporation ( NASDAQ:
DECK ) rallied in today's trading. The stock touched a 52-week high of $82.97
today, and closed 6.53% higher at $8.288, with volume up from daily average of
1.83 million to 4.46 million. The Deckers Outdoor stock has a 52-week range of
$29.94-$82.97. Year-to-date, the stock is up an impressive 144.41%. Deckers
Outdoor is a Goleta, California-based company, engaged in the designing,
production, marketing and managing of footwear and accessories. The company is
engaged in the sales of its products through domestic retailers and
international distributors. Shares of SEACOR Holdings Inc. ( NYSE: CKH ) gained
in today's trading. The stock touched a 52-week high of $113.56 and ended the
day 0.37% higher at $112.30, with volume up from daily aveage of 220,761 to
473,178. The SEACOR stock has a 52-week range of $67.02-$113.56. Year-to-date,
it is up 47.28%. Fort Lauderdale, Florida-based SEACOR Holdings is diversified
company. The company is the owner and operator of marine and aviation assets
mainly servicing the oil and gas, industrial aviation and marine transportation
industries.
